The Paradox of Efficiency and Visibility

The current wave of Digital Transformation is defined by the rapid deployment of autonomous systems designed to streamline productivity. From a purely economic standpoint, the allure is undeniable. By leveraging AI Agents to manage customer interactions, analyze complex datasets, or optimize supply chain logistics, companies can achieve levels of scale and precision that were unimaginable a decade ago. However, every automated workflow introduces a layer of abstraction between the human stakeholder and the core business logic.

This is where the "Trojan horse" analogy finds its commercial teeth. When an organization embeds an automated agent into its Customer Relationship Management (CRM) system to handle lead qualification, the ROI is immediate: lower operational overhead and faster response times. Yet, if the underlying models are opaque or the data integration is poorly managed, the firm risks losing the nuance of the customer experience. The risk is not necessarily "malevolent" AI; it is the risk of losing agency over the processes that define your brand.

To mitigate this, business leaders must prioritize "explainable AI" (XAI) frameworks as a prerequisite for deployment. Implementing AI shouldn't mean abdicating oversight. Instead, adoption trends reveal a pivot toward human-in-the-loop systems where technology acts as an amplifier rather than a black-box replacement. Consider the following strategic imperatives for the modern business:

  • Data Provenance: Ensure that the data feeding your models is audited, clean, and proprietary to maintain a competitive advantage.
  • Infrastructure Interoperability: Avoid vendor lock-in by building modular systems that can pivot as the landscape of foundational models shifts.
  • Ethical Guardrails: Establish internal governance protocols that mandate regular stress testing of AI-driven decision-making outputs.
  • Operational Continuity: Design systems that possess manual override capabilities, ensuring that automated tasks can be reclaimed by human teams if the model drifts.

Navigating the Frontier of Automated Workflows

We are currently witnessing a shift from "AI as a tool" to "AI as a teammate." In sectors ranging from fintech to healthcare, Custom Software solutions are increasingly built around the capability of autonomous agents to navigate CRM records and internal databases independently. While this evolution promises to eliminate the friction of repetitive administrative work, it creates a new mandate for IT departments: the management of latent complexity.

The ROI implications here are significant. Companies that view AI as a "plug-and-play" commodity often find themselves dealing with fragmented data silos and escalating technical debt. Conversely, those that treat AI as a long-term architectural commitment—much like they would view a foundational shift in cloud infrastructure—are the ones seeing consistent returns. Adoption is not just about purchasing a subscription to an API; it is about re-engineering the enterprise to handle the speed at which AI works.

If a company automates its customer service using an advanced Chatbot architecture without first mapping its internal knowledge silos, it is simply automating chaos. The "Trojan horse" threat, in this context, is the assumption that technology can fix broken processes. The most successful organizations are using this period of rapid innovation to clean their "digital attic" before layering intelligence on top of it.

The future of business will belong to those who treat AI not as a magic bullet, but as a sophisticated lever. It requires a pragmatic approach that values transparency over hype. By focusing on modular, scalable architecture, companies can extract maximum value from their automation initiatives without surrendering control to the black box. The goal is to build an environment where the sophistication of your software is matched only by the rigor of your oversight, ensuring that your technological investments serve your strategic objectives rather than dictating them.
